[Bug 1969720] [NEW] Leap2A import fails
Public bug reported:
When a new account is created with a previously exported file from the
same site (and also a different one), I get the following error message:
[WAR] 37 (lib/errors.php:537) Data array supplied when object expected at /var/www/master-dev-prod-mahara/releases/20220420173606/artefact/internal/lib.php:450
Call stack (most recent first):
exception(object(MaharaException)) at Unknown:0
With an export of the 'student' account from the demo site
https://demo.mahara.org, I get a lot more warnings (see attached).
1. Log in as Admin
2. Add a new user via Leap2A file (or a combined export if you have a more recent site).
3. Fill in a username and password
4. Click “Create account” button
Results:
- Expected: A new account is crated and found in the 'People search'.
- Actual: Error from above and attached.
** Affects: mahara
Importance: High
Status: Confirmed
